Shrine of Remembrance

Shrine of Remembrance, located in St Kilda Road, is one of the largest war memorials in Australia

It now serves as a memorial for all Australians who served in war and it is the site of annual observances of ANZAC Day (25 April) and Remembrance Day (11 November).









Around the Sanctuary walls is a frieze of 12 carved panels depicting the armed services at work and in action during World War I.

The Sanctuary contains the marble Stone of Remembrance, upon which is engraved the words "Greater love hath no man". Once a year, on 11 November at 11 a.m. (Remembrance Day), a ray of sunlight shines through an aperture in the roof to light up the word "Love" in the inscription.
